Manchester United XI vs West Brom: Confirmed team news and lineup - Rashford starts, no Pogba or Greenwood

Manchester United manager Ole Gunnar Solskjaer has a few fitness issues for the visit of West Brom.

Defenders Luke Shaw and Eric Bailly are sidelined, though Victor Lindelof has recovered from a back complaint to start.

Alex Telles tested negative for coronavirus during the international break, and is named at left-back.

Up front, Marcus Rashford sat out England duty with a shoulder injury and has spent the last week or so back at Carrington - but he starts here.

Anthony Martial also starts, but Mason Greenwood has been left out of the squad.

Donny van de Beek is still waiting for his first League start since arriving, and there is no room for Paul Pogba in the squad.

Manchester United lineup: de Gea, Wan Bissaka, Lindelof, Maguire, Alex Telles, Matic, Fred, Mata, Bruno Fernandes, Rashford, Martial

Subs: Cavani, James, Henderson, Williams, Van de Beek, Tuanzebe, McTominay

West Brom lineup: Johnstone, Furlong, Ajayi, Bartley, Ivanovic, Townsend, Matheus Pereira, Sawyers, Gallagher, Diangana, Ahearne-Grant

Subs: Robson-Kanu, Robinson, Phillips, Harper, Krovinovic, Button, O'Shea

Referee: David Coote
